Schedule Routine Furnace Tune-Ups


If you plan preventive maintenance for your heater now, it will work better this winter, and you won't have to pay as much for repairs. Many heating and cooling companies provide annual fall maintenance checks for heating systems. By checking and adjusting the heater, problems are less likely to happen when it is working the hardest.


The heating system’s ignition will be checked, the filters will be inspected, minor components will be adjusted, and the burners will be cleaned. This facilitates having the parts stay in good working order for longer.


Change the Air Filter


While professionals can inspect your furnace thoroughly once a year and make small changes, you should still change the filter on your furnace every 1 to 3 months.


You might need to give more thought to the air filter's role in the efficiency of your heater. The airflow to your system is impeded when it is dirty. The motors will have to work more than necessary to warm your home, which wastes energy. A lot of the time, we can avoid having to fix the furnace by simply changing the air filter.


Notice the Signs


It's possible that your heating system already needs servicing, and you're just ignoring the signs. However, it is preferable to identify the issue as soon as possible. A furnace repair that is delayed might quickly become out of hand. At the first hint of problems, immediately contact a technician.


  • Fluctuations and drops in temperature.
  • Certain areas of the house are unusually toasty.
  • Strange sounds are coming from the machine.
  • Short cycling.


Don’t Overwork the Heater


Last but not least, we recommend not making your heater work harder than it has to. Do you, for instance, crank up the thermostat when you arrive home from work on a chilly evening to hasten the rate at which your home heats up? However, this is not the case, as extended operation wastes energy and puts unnecessary strain on the system.


Instead, pick a comfortable temperature and set your thermostat accordingly before leaving work. The most convenient method to achieve this is installing a Wi-Fi thermostat, which can be adjusted anywhere.

Why You Should Schedule Heating Maintenance Annually


Neglecting routine maintenance on a perfectly functional heating system is a surefire way to invite trouble. You must take care of this maintenance every year, or you'll lose about 5 percent of your efficiency. However, if you get your heater serviced regularly, you can keep it running at 95% of its original efficiency for much longer. In addition, as we've already indicated, regular maintenance can eliminate the need for as much as 85% of the problems that could arise in the lifetime of your heater.


The heating in your home has seen better days. True of any substantial home appliance. We'll let you know if any minor repairs that came up during planned maintenance need to be made. To illustrate, consider the blower motor in your home heating system. The motor is securely fastened in place by bearings. Lubrication on the bearings prevents the motor from being damaged by the friction that happens during constant movement. Over time, the motor's bearings will wear down and cause more friction. The bearings should be oiled or replaced. When put in perspective, this is not a huge issue that needs fixing.


If you neglect to address this issue or are unaware of it due to a lack of preventative maintenance, the resulting friction will eventually cause the motor to overheat and the furnace or heating system to fail. Because of this, you'll have to spend more money on maintenance, on a brand new fan motor. That's one way that preventative maintenance can lengthen the time between heating system repairs.


“What Else Can I Do to Prevent Heating Repairs?”


To begin, swap out the filter in your forced-air heater. The air filter stops things like dust and dirt from getting into the system and hurting the parts inside. However, airflow is impeded when the filter is excessively clogged. If this is the case, your heating system (whether a furnace or a heat pump) may have to work harder than usual to achieve the temperature you've set. As a result, it consumes more electricity, which raises costs. But it also speeds up the wear and tear on your heater, leading to more frequent maintenance needs.
